#e493bf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e493bf is composed of 89.4% red, 57.6%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.5% magenta, 16.2%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 327.4 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 73.5%. #e493bf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c9277f.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#e493bf
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#fcf1f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e493bf
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c0b7bc is the less saturated color, while #fe79c1 is the most saturated one.
